黑狐家游戏

关系型数据库是啥,关系型数据库是干嘛

欧气 2 0

标题:探索关系型数据库的奥秘与应用

一、引言

在当今数字化时代,数据已成为企业和组织的重要资产,如何有效地管理和利用这些数据,成为了摆在我们面前的重要课题,关系型数据库作为一种广泛应用的数据管理技术,为我们提供了一种高效、可靠的数据存储和管理方式,本文将深入探讨关系型数据库的基本概念、特点、优势以及其在实际应用中的场景,帮助读者更好地理解和掌握这一重要技术。

二、关系型数据库的基本概念

关系型数据库是一种以表格形式组织数据的数据库管理系统,它通过建立表之间的关系,实现了数据的关联和一致性,在关系型数据库中,每个表都有一个唯一的标识符,称为主键,主键用于唯一标识表中的每一行数据,并且在表之间建立了关联,关系型数据库还支持多种数据类型,如整数、字符串、日期等,以满足不同类型数据的存储需求。

三、关系型数据库的特点

1、数据结构化:关系型数据库将数据组织成表格形式,每个表格都有明确的结构和字段定义,这种结构化的数据组织方式使得数据易于理解和管理,同时也便于进行数据查询和分析。

2、数据一致性:关系型数据库通过建立表之间的关系,确保了数据的一致性,在一个学生信息表和一个课程信息表中,如果学生选修了某门课程,那么在这两个表中都应该有相应的记录,并且学生的学号和课程的编号应该是一致的。

3、数据独立性:关系型数据库将数据的存储和逻辑结构分离,使得应用程序可以独立于数据的存储方式进行开发和维护,这种数据独立性提高了应用程序的可移植性和可维护性。

4、数据安全性:关系型数据库提供了多种数据安全机制,如用户认证、授权、访问控制等,以确保数据的安全性和保密性。

5、数据查询语言标准化:关系型数据库使用结构化查询语言(SQL)作为数据查询语言,SQL 是一种标准化的语言,具有简单易学、功能强大等特点,使得数据查询和分析变得更加容易和高效。

四、关系型数据库的优势

1、简单易用:关系型数据库的概念和操作相对简单,易于理解和掌握,对于初学者来说,学习关系型数据库的成本较低。

2、数据一致性和完整性:关系型数据库通过建立表之间的关系,确保了数据的一致性和完整性,这对于需要保证数据准确性和可靠性的应用场景来说非常重要。

3、数据查询和分析高效:关系型数据库使用 SQL 作为数据查询语言,SQL 具有强大的查询和分析功能,可以快速地从大量数据中提取所需的信息。

4、广泛的应用场景:关系型数据库适用于各种应用场景,如企业资源规划(ERP)、客户关系管理(CRM)、财务管理等。

5、成熟的技术和丰富的经验:关系型数据库是一种成熟的技术,已经在企业级应用中得到了广泛的应用,也有大量的技术文档和经验可供参考,这使得开发和维护关系型数据库系统变得更加容易。

五、关系型数据库的应用场景

1、企业资源规划(ERP):ERP 系统需要管理企业的各种资源,如人力、物力、财力等,关系型数据库可以有效地存储和管理这些资源的相关数据,为 ERP 系统的运行提供支持。

2、客户关系管理(CRM):CRM 系统需要管理客户的各种信息,如客户基本信息、销售记录、服务记录等,关系型数据库可以方便地存储和管理这些客户信息,为 CRM 系统的营销和服务提供支持。

3、财务管理:财务管理系统需要管理企业的财务数据,如财务报表、预算、成本等,关系型数据库可以有效地存储和管理这些财务数据,为财务管理系统的决策提供支持。

4、电子商务:电子商务系统需要管理商品信息、订单信息、用户信息等,关系型数据库可以方便地存储和管理这些电子商务数据,为电子商务系统的运营提供支持。

5、数据分析和挖掘:关系型数据库可以存储大量的结构化数据,这些数据可以用于数据分析和挖掘,通过使用 SQL 和数据分析工具,可以从关系型数据库中提取有价值的信息,为企业的决策提供支持。

六、关系型数据库的发展趋势

1、云数据库:随着云计算技术的发展,云数据库逐渐成为关系型数据库的发展趋势,云数据库具有弹性扩展、高可用性、低成本等优点,可以为企业提供更加灵活和高效的数据存储和管理服务。

2、NoSQL 数据库:NoSQL 数据库是一种非关系型数据库,它具有灵活的数据模型、高可扩展性、高性能等优点,随着大数据和互联网应用的发展,NoSQL 数据库逐渐受到关注,成为关系型数据库的有力竞争对手。

3、内存数据库:内存数据库是一种将数据存储在内存中的数据库,它具有高速读写、低延迟等优点,随着数据量的不断增加和对数据实时性要求的不断提高,内存数据库逐渐成为关系型数据库的发展方向之一。

4、分布式数据库:分布式数据库是一种将数据分布在多个节点上的数据库,它具有高可用性、高性能、可扩展性等优点,随着企业数字化转型的加速和对数据处理能力要求的不断提高,分布式数据库逐渐成为关系型数据库的重要发展方向之一。

七、结论

关系型数据库作为一种广泛应用的数据管理技术,具有数据结构化、数据一致性、数据独立性、数据安全性和数据查询语言标准化等特点,它适用于各种应用场景,如企业资源规划、客户关系管理、财务管理、电子商务和数据分析等,随着云计算、大数据、互联网应用和企业数字化转型的加速,关系型数据库也在不断发展和创新,如云数据库、NoSQL 数据库、内存数据库和分布式数据库等,关系型数据库将继续发挥其重要作用,为企业和组织的数字化转型和发展提供有力支持。

标签: #关系型数据库 #数据存储 #关系模型 #数据管理

黑狐家游戏
  • 评论列表

留言评论